URJ offers Jewish-inspired human resources to the Jewish world

Summary by eJewish Philanthropy
There’s a good chance many synagogues aren’t in compliance with state and federal workplace laws, Barry Mael, senior director of synagogue affiliations, operations and program support at the United Synagogue of Conservative Judaism (USCJ), told eJewishPhilanthropy. “Not purposefully, but just because they dont know certain laws.” When synagogues can’t afford human resource staff, everything falls onto the executive director’s shoulders, and they…
